Revolutionizing Erectile Dysfunction Treatment: The Promise of Gene Therapy

Erectile dysfunction (ED) is a typical condition affecting hundreds of thousands of males worldwide, characterized by the lack to achieve or maintain an erection ample for satisfactory sexual efficiency. Traditional treatments have included oral medications similar to phosphodiesterase type 5 inhibitors (PDE5i), vacuum erection units, penile injections, and surgical choices. However, these treatments usually include limitations, together with unwanted effects, the need for ongoing administration, and varying effectiveness. One of the most promising avenues in gene therapy for ED is the supply of genes that encode for proteins concerned within the nitric oxide (NO) signaling pathway. Nitric oxide is a vital molecule for attaining an erection, as it promotes the relaxation of smooth muscle in the penile tissue, allowing for increased blood circulate. In men with erectile dysfunction, the NO signaling pathway could also be impaired, leading to insufficient blood movement and issue achieving an erection.

Researchers have been investigating the usage of gene transfer strategies to ship genes that improve the manufacturing of nitric oxide or its signaling pathway. For instance, research have shown that the delivery of the endothelial nitric oxide synthase (eNOS) gene can considerably improve erectile perform in animal fashions of ED. By increasing the expression of eNOS, these therapies can boost nitric oxide levels, resulting in improved blood circulation and enhanced erectile response.

Another approach includes using vascular endothelial development factor (VEGF) gene therapy. VEGF is a signaling protein that stimulates the formation of recent blood vessels, a course of often known as angiogenesis. By selling angiogenesis within the penile tissue, VEGF gene therapy might help restore normal erectile function in men with vascular-related ED. Preclinical research have demonstrated that VEGF gene therapy can improve erectile perform and penile blood circulate in animal fashions, paving the way in which for potential clinical applications.

The development of gene therapy for ED has progressed to clinical trials, with a number of studies investigating the security and efficacy of these novel treatments. In a single notable trial, researchers administered a gene therapy product targeting the eNOS gene to males with ED who had not responded to traditional treatments. The results were promising, displaying vital improvements in erectile function as measured by validated questionnaires and goal assessments.

Moreover, gene therapy has the benefit of being a one-time treatment that may present long-lasting effects. Not like oral medications that require common dosing, gene therapy aims to induce a sustained biological response by way of the expression of therapeutic genes. This could tremendously enhance the quality of life for men affected by erectile dysfunction, reducing the need for ongoing remedy and its related costs.

Nevertheless, as with every rising treatment modality, gene therapy for erectile dysfunction shouldn't be with out challenges. Security issues relating to potential opposed effects, reminiscent of inflammatory responses or unintended genetic modifications, have to be totally evaluated in clinical trials.
